ASP中高效分页查询技术的实现策略探究

在ASP(Active Server Pages)开发中,分页查询是处理大量数据时常见的需求。当数据量较大时,直接加载全部数据会导致页面响应缓慢,影响用户体验。因此,采用高效的分页技术至关重要。

AI绘图,仅供参考

实现高效分页的关键在于减少数据库的负载和网络传输的数据量。通常,可以使用SQL语句中的LIMIT和OFFSET子句来实现分页功能。通过指定每页显示的记录数和当前页码,可以有效地限制返回的数据量。

同时,合理设计数据库索引也是提升分页性能的重要手段。为经常用于排序和筛选的字段建立索引,能够显著加快查询速度,尤其是在大数据量的情况下。

在ASP中,可以通过动态生成SQL语句的方式实现分页逻辑。例如,根据用户请求的页码计算起始记录位置,并将其作为参数传递给数据库查询。这样可以避免一次性加载过多数据,提高系统响应效率。

另外,还可以结合前端技术优化分页体验。例如,使用AJAX异步加载数据,使用户在翻页时无需刷新整个页面,从而提升交互流畅性。

总体而言,ASP中高效分页查询的实现需要综合考虑数据库优化、SQL语句设计以及前后端协同工作,才能在保证性能的同时提供良好的用户体验。

dawei

【声明】:嘉兴站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复